The article discusses the latest features of Ansys Gateway powered by AWS, a cloud engineering solution for running Ansys simulations with automatically scaling HPC clusters.
- Introduces dynamic cluster provisioning using AWS ParallelCluster and Slurm workload manager
- Supports multiple storage options including Amazon EFS, FSx for Lustre, and FSx for OpenZFS
- Enables job-based simulation workflows instead of static cluster approach
- Provides simplified job submission through Ansys HPC Platform Services (HPS)
- Supports multiple Ansys applications across various Amazon EC2 instance types
Key benefits include improved resource utilization, cost optimization, and scalability for engineering simulations by dynamically adjusting compute resources based on workload requirements.
